Synthesis of 2-substituted tryptophans via a C3- to C2-alkyl migration

MARI, MICHELE;LUCARINI, SIMONE;BARTOCCINI, FRANCESCA;PIERSANTI, GIOVANNI;SPADONI, GILBERTO
2014

Abstract

The reaction of 3-substituted indoles with dehydroalanine (Dha) derivatives under Lewis acid-mediated conditions has been investigated. The formation of 2-substituted tryptophans is proposed to occur through a selective alkylative dearomatization–cyclization followed by C3- to C2-alkyl migration and rearomatization.
